DCW writes to police over viral video of child assault


New Delhi, Jul 23 (IANS): Delhi Commission for Women chairperson Swati Maliwal on Tuesday wrote to Delhi Police asking for investigation into a viral video showing an elderly man sexually assaulting a toddler.

Maliwal also shared the video on Twitter appealing to the people and the police to identify arrest the culprit. But later she deleted the clip after people criticised her for sharing such a video.

In the video, the elderly man was assaulting the child when people entered the room and made a video of the same.

Maliwal said stringent action should be taken in the matter.

"While the commission is unaware of the location of the incident, considering the seriousness of the matter a Zero FIR must be registered by Delhi Police urgently and investigation should be carried out immediately," said Maliwal.

She also sought an action taken report from the police by July 30.
